Urolithin A is a compound produced in the colon through the metabolism of ellagitannins (found in foods like pomegranates and walnuts) by gut microbiota. Ellagitannins are first converted to ellagic acid, which is then metabolized into Urolithin A by specific gut bacteria. Notably, only about 40% of people have the gut microbiota capable of efficiently converting ellagitannins into Urolithin A, making individual differences in gut health and diet important factors in its production.

Role of Gut Microbiota

The human colon microflora plays a crucial role in the production of Urolithin A. Here’s how the process works:

  • Step 1: Dietary intake of ellagitannins from foods such as pomegranates, walnuts, and berries.
  • Step 2: Ellagitannins are first converted to ellagic acid in the gut.
  • Step 3: Specific gut bacteria, such as Enterocloster and Gordonibacter species, metabolize ellagic acid into Urolithin A.
  • Step 4: Only about 40% of people have the gut microbiota composition necessary to efficiently produce Urolithin A.

The presence of these bacteria and their microbial enzymes is essential for Urolithin A production, highlighting the importance of maintaining a healthy gut microbiome. Dietary factors, such as consuming foods rich in ellagic acid, influence the ability to produce Urolithin A by supporting the growth of beneficial bacteria.

Effects on Energy Metabolism

Mitophagy and Mitochondrial Renewal

Urolithin A optimizes energy metabolism by enhancing mitochondrial function within muscle cells. Through mitophagy, it helps remove damaged mitochondria and promotes growth of new, healthy ones. This renewal is essential for robust energy production, as mitochondria are cellular powerhouses.

Energy Production and Endurance

Clinical trials show Urolithin A supplementation significantly improves muscle endurance and reduces muscle fatigue, especially in middle-aged adults. By supporting mitochondrial health and efficiency, Urolithin A boosts muscle health and sustains energy during physical activity. This translates to better exercise performance, allowing individuals to push workouts with less fatigue and greater stamina. Connection to the Immune System

Beyond muscle and mitochondrial health, Urolithin A supports immune function. Its anti-inflammatory properties reduce chronic inflammation, a key factor in many age-related diseases. Research indicates Urolithin A lowers inflammatory markers like C-reactive protein and promotes anti-inflammatory cytokines for balanced immune responses.

Additionally, Urolithin A exhibits antimicrobial effects, helping control harmful microorganisms in the gut and supporting a healthier gut microbiome.
